We are currently running CLM 3.0 which contains additional cloud data that
is not present in Atrium 8.0. We initially tried to use the CMDBDriver
utility, but since its version specific we have been unsuccessful.

The issue we are having is that the source Atrium has certain CMDB
extensions that do not (and should not) exist on the target Atrium.
Specifically, the CLM Cloud Extensions are installed on the source Atrium.
When we run an import using the *CMDBDriver utility* on the stand-alone
Atrium 8, we get import errors (120004) complaining that attributes in the
XML import files does not exist in the target dataset. We know what the
issue is, but are unsure how to solve it. Essentially, we want to export a
subset data from CLM 3.0 Atrium. For a given dataset, we want to export all
classes & attributes that exist in the BMC.CORE, BMC.AM, and possibly
BMC.FED namespaces. Even when specifying a specific namespace to export,
the resulting XML files still contain attributes that are provided by other
namespaces. This subsequently causes imports to fail, since there is
"extra" data.
